Calcolatore Dati di Accesso
Guida Completa alla Calcolazione dei Dati di Accesso
La gestione efficace dei dati di accesso è fondamentale per qualsiasi organizzazione che dipende da sistemi informatici. Questa guida approfondita esplorerà tutti gli aspetti della calcolazione dei dati di accesso, fornendo metodologie pratiche, formule matematiche e best practice per ottimizzare le risorse IT.
1. Fondamenti della Calcolazione dei Dati di Accesso
I dati di accesso rappresentano il volume di informazioni che vengono lette, scritte o modificate in un sistema informatico durante un determinato periodo. La corretta calcolazione di questi dati permette di:
- Dimensionare correttamente l’infrastruttura di storage
- Ottimizzare la larghezza di banda della rete
- Prevedere i costi operativi
- Migliorare le prestazioni del sistema
- Garantire la conformità normativa
2. Parametri Chiave per il Calcolo
Per eseguire una calcolazione accurata dei dati di accesso, è necessario considerare diversi parametri fondamentali:
- Volume dei dati: La quantità totale di dati da gestire, misurata tipicamente in GB o TB
- Frequenza di accesso: Quante volte i dati vengono accessi in un determinato periodo (giornaliero, settimanale, mensile)
- Numero di utenti: Quanti utenti simultanei accedono ai dati
- Tipo di dati: La natura dei dati (testo, immagini, video, dati sensibili) influenza le dimensioni e le esigenze di elaborazione
- Durata di conservazione: Per quanto tempo i dati devono essere mantenuti accessibili
- Livello di compressione: Se e come i dati vengono compressi per ottimizzare lo storage
3. Formule Matematiche per il Calcolo
Le seguenti formule rappresentano il nucleo della calcolazione dei dati di accesso:
3.1 Calcolo dello Storage Richiesto
La formula base per calcolare lo storage necessario è:
Storage Totale = Volume Dati × (1 – Livello Compressione) × Numero Copie × Durata Conservazione
Dove:
- Livello Compressione: 0 per nessuna, 0.2 per bassa, 0.4 per media, 0.6 per alta compressione
- Numero Copie: Tipicamente 2-3 per backup e ridondanza
3.2 Calcolo della Larghezza di Banda
La banda necessaria si calcola con:
Banda = (Volume Dati × Frequenza Accesso × Numero Utenti) / (Tempo Disponibile × 8)
Nota: si divide per 8 per convertire da byte a bit (1 byte = 8 bit)
3.3 Calcolo dei Costi
I costi totali si compongono di:
Costo Totale = (Costo Storage × Storage Totale) + (Costo Banda × Banda) + Costi Operativi
4. Confronto tra Diverse Soluzioni di Storage
| Soluzione | Costo/GB/mese | Latenza | Scalabilità | Affidabilità | Casi d’Uso Ideali |
|---|---|---|---|---|---|
| HDD Locale | €0.02 | 5-10ms | Limitata | Media | Archiviazione cold data, backup |
| SSD Locale | €0.08 | 1-3ms | Moderata | Alta | Database, applicazioni critiche |
| Cloud Storage (Standard) | €0.023 | 10-50ms | Elevata | Molto Alta | Applicazioni web, backup remoto |
| Cloud Storage (Premium) | €0.12 | 1-5ms | Elevata | Molto Alta | Big data, analytics in tempo reale |
| NAS/SAN | €0.05 | 2-8ms | Moderata | Alta | Condivisione file aziendale |
5. Impatto della Compressione sui Dati
La compressione dei dati gioca un ruolo cruciale nell’ottimizzazione dello storage e della banda. Ecco un confronto tra diversi livelli di compressione:
| Livello Compressione | Riduzione Dimensione | Impatto CPU | Tempo Compr./Decompr. | Casi d’Uso Ideali |
|---|---|---|---|---|
| Nessuna | 0% | Nessuno | 0ms | Dati già compressi (immagini JPEG, video MP4) |
| Bassa | 20-30% | Minimo | <50ms | Testo, documenti, log |
| Media | 40-60% | Moderato | 50-200ms | Database, file binari |
| Alta | 60-80% | Elevato | 200-500ms | Archiviazione a lungo termine, backup |
6. Best Practice per l’Ottimizzazione
- Analisi dei pattern di accesso: Utilizzare strumenti di monitoring per identificare quando e come i dati vengono accessi, permettendo di ottimizzare cache e pre-fetching.
- Tiered Storage: Implementare una strategia di storage a livelli, dove i dati più frequentementi accessi risiedono su supporti più veloci (e costosi) mentre quelli meno usati su supporti più economici.
- Deduplicazione: Eliminare i dati ridondanti per ridurre significativamente lo spazio occupato, particolarmente efficace per backup e dati simili.
- Cache intelligente: Implementare sistemi di caching che mantengano in memoria i dati più frequentementi accessi, riducendo i tempi di lettura.
- Compressione selettiva: Applicare diversi livelli di compressione in base al tipo di dato e alla frequenza di accesso.
- Monitoraggio continuo: Utilizzare strumenti come Prometheus, Grafana o soluzioni cloud native per monitorare in tempo reale l’utilizzo delle risorse.
7. Normative e Conformità
La gestione dei dati di accesso deve tenere conto delle normative vigenti in materia di protezione dei dati e privacy. In Europa, il Regolamento Generale sulla Protezione dei Dati (GDPR) impone requisiti stringenti sulla conservazione e l’accesso ai dati personali.
Negli Stati Uniti, normative come:
- HIPAA per i dati sanitari
- Regolamenti SEC per i dati finanziari
definiscono specifici requisiti per l’accesso e la conservazione dei dati.
È fondamentale:
- Mantenere registri dettagliati di tutti gli accessi ai dati sensibili
- Implementare sistemi di autenticazione forte (MFA)
- Cifrare i dati sia in transito che a riposo
- Definire politiche chiare di retention dei dati
- Eseguire audit regolari dei sistemi di accesso
8. Strumenti per la Calcolazione e il Monitoraggio
Esistono numerosi strumenti professionali per aiutare nella calcolazione e nell’ottimizzazione dei dati di accesso:
- AWS Cost Explorer: Per stimare i costi di storage e banda su AWS
- Azure Pricing Calculator: Strumento simile per l’ecosistema Microsoft Azure
- Google Cloud’s Pricing Calculator: Per progetti su Google Cloud Platform
- NetApp OnCommand: Soluzione enterprise per la gestione dello storage
- SolarWinds Storage Resource Monitor: Monitoraggio avanzato delle risorse di storage
- Prometheus + Grafana: Soluzione open-source per il monitoring delle prestazioni
9. Casi Studio Reali
Caso 1: Azienda E-commerce
Un grande sito e-commerce con 50.000 prodotti e 10.000 visitatori giornalieri ha implementato:
- Compressione media per le immagini dei prodotti (riduzione del 50% dello spazio)
- Cache aggressiva per le pagine prodotto più popolari
- Storage a livelli con SSD per i prodotti in evidenza e HDD per l’archivio
- CDN per la distribuzione globale dei contenuti statici
Risultati: Riduzione del 60% dei costi di banda e miglioramento del 40% nei tempi di caricamento.
Caso 2: Istituzione Sanitaria
Un ospedale con 2TB di dati pazienti (incluse immagini medicali) ha adottato:
- Compressione alta per le immagini medicali (riduzione del 70% dello spazio)
- Storage conforme HIPAA con cifratura end-to-end
- Sistema di tiered storage con accesso immediato ai dati degli ultimi 2 anni
- Autenticazione a due fattori per tutti gli accessi
Risultati: Conformità normativa mantenuta con una riduzione del 30% dei costi di storage.
10. Errori Comuni da Evitare
- Sottostimare la crescita dei dati: I dati tendono a crescere esponenzialmente. Prevedere sempre un buffer del 30-50% in più rispetto alle stime iniziali.
- Ignorare i costi nascosti: Oltre allo storage, considerare costi di banda, backup, sicurezza e manutenzione.
- Trascurare la ridondanza: Non avere copie di backup adeguate può portare a perdite catastrofiche di dati.
- Sovra-comprimere dati frequenti: La compressione alta su dati accessi frequentemente può degradare le prestazioni a causa dell’overhead di decompressione.
- Non monitorare le prestazioni: Senza monitoring continuo, è impossibile identificare colli di bottiglia o opportunità di ottimizzazione.
- Dimenticare la conformità: Non rispettare le normative può portare a sanzioni pesanti (fino al 4% del fatturato globale per GDPR).
- Usare soluzioni “one-size-fits-all”: Ogni carico di lavoro ha esigenze diverse. Adattare la soluzione al caso specifico.
11. Tendenze Future
Il campo della gestione dei dati di accesso è in rapida evoluzione. Alcune tendenze chiave da monitorare:
- Intelligenza Artificiale: Sistemi che predicono i pattern di accesso e ottimizzano automaticamente lo storage.
- Edge Computing: Elaborazione dei dati più vicina alla fonte per ridurre latenza e banda.
- Storage DNA: Tecnologie emergenti che utilizzano il DNA per l’archiviazione a lungo termine (densità di 215 milioni di GB per grammo).
- Quantum Storage: Soluzioni basate su computing quantistico per gestire volumi di dati impensabili oggi.
- Automazione Completa: Sistemi che gestiscono automaticamente tiering, compressione e backup senza intervento umano.
- Blockchain per l’Audit: Utilizzo della blockchain per tracciare in modo immutabile tutti gli accessi ai dati sensibili.
12. Risorse Addizionali
Per approfondire l’argomento:
- NIST Special Publication 800-88: Linee guida per la cancellazione sicura dei media di storage
- ISO/IEC 27040: Standard internazionale per la sicurezza dello storage
- SNIA Cloud Storage Initiative: Risorse e best practice per lo storage cloud
13. Conclusione
La corretta calcolazione e gestione dei dati di accesso è un elemento critico per il successo di qualsiasi organizzazione nell’era digitale. Seguendo le metodologie descritte in questa guida, implementando le best practice e utilizzando gli strumenti appropriati, è possibile ottimizzare significativamente le risorse IT, ridurre i costi e migliorare le prestazioni dei sistemi.
Ricordate che la gestione dei dati non è un’attività “once-and-done”, ma un processo continuo che richiede monitoraggio, adattamento e miglioramento costanti. Con l’evoluzione delle tecnologie e l’aumento esponenziale dei dati, mantenersi aggiornati sulle ultime tendenze e soluzioni è essenziale per rimanere competitivi.
Iniziate con il nostro calcolatore per avere una stima iniziale delle vostre esigenze, poi approfondite con gli strumenti e le risorse menzionate per sviluppare una strategia di gestione dei dati veramente efficace e su misura per la vostra organizzazione.